Parts of northern Hong Kong face highest climate disaster risk, study finds

Parts of northern Hong Kong face the highest risk of climate-related disasters, a study by the Hong Kong Red Cross has found, with the charity urging the government to take climate resilience planning into account in developing the area. A report released by the charity on Thursday also said that more than 50 per cent of the city faced high-risk threats from two or three types of hazards, such as typhoons, extreme heat or fires, simultaneously. “In planning Hong Kong’s future, this risk map...
